Final week, Bell Sports activities Inc. (which incorporates Giro), in cooperation with the Client Product Security Fee (CSPC) and Well being Canada, introduced a voluntary recall of the Giro Advantage Helmet.
The helmets could have a difficulty the place the straps could be pulled from the helmet with out a lot drive. Any Advantage helmet made earlier than January 2023 is affected by this recall, together with males’s and ladies’s variations. Shoppers ought to cease utilizing recalled merchandise instantly.

Identify of Product: Giro Advantage (GH230)
Items: 4,611
Importer: Bell Sports activities, Inc. of Scotts Valley, California
Hazard: “The helmet straps on some Giro Advantage helmets manufactured previous to January 2023 could disengage with the helmet when pulled with comparatively little drive, posing a threat of damage to the consumer”.
Incidents: Giro will not be conscious of any incidents within the subject.
Description: This recall solely entails Giro Advantage helmets manufactured previous to January 2023 that have been offered in Australia, New Zealand, america of America, and Canada. A Giro Advantage helmet could be recognized by the mannequin identify “Advantage” on the rear/aspect of the helmet. It may also be recognized by the internal helmet sticker which has the mannequin identify “Advantage” written on it and in addition bears the alphanumeric identifier (GH230)
Bought by: Backcountry.com, Freewheel Bike West Financial institution, Velotech, Epicenter Biking, and different related retailers.
Manufactured in: China
Treatment: Shoppers ought to cease utilizing the helmet instantly and make contact with Giro for a alternative, freed from cost.
